Sock Care Guide – How to Make Your Socks Last Longer

To keep your socks comfortable, durable, and looking new for as long as possible, follow these simple care tips.

1. Wash Socks Inside Out

Always turn socks inside out before washing. This helps remove sweat, bacteria, and skin particles while protecting the outer fabric and colors.

2. Wash at Low Temperature

Wash socks at 30–40°C (86–104°F). Lower temperatures protect cotton fibers and elastic threads, helping socks keep their shape and durability.

3. Wash Before First Wear

New socks should be washed before the first use. This removes production residues and allows the fibers to soften and settle naturally.

4. Avoid Tumble Drying

Whenever possible, air dry your socks. High heat from tumble dryers can weaken elastic fibers and shorten the lifespan of your socks.

5. Wash with Similar Colors

To maintain vibrant colors:

  • wash dark socks with dark clothing

  • wash white socks separately

  • wash bright colors with similar shades

6. Do Not Overload the Washing Machine

Avoid overloading your washing machine. Giving socks enough space reduces friction and prevents unnecessary fabric wear.

7. Store Socks Properly

Fold socks together instead of stretching them into tight balls. This helps preserve the elasticity and shape of the sock.

Originals Fine Rib Socks — Red Moon

A lunar eclipse turns the moon a deep, rusty red — warm, dramatic, and unlike anything else in the sky. That is the colour logic of Red Moon: a dark, warm red with terracotta-orange undertones, deeper than a true red, earthier than a classic scarlet. Not the cool wine-red of Bordeaux, not the warm coral of Watermelon — this is the red that belongs to the warm, earthy wardrobe: brown leather, tan suede, denim, and white sneakers. Photographed with New Balance and Air Force 1s for a reason. Same 200-needle organic combed cotton construction and hand-linked toe, OEKO-TEX certified, knitted in Istanbul. Designed in Copenhagen.

Colour & Styling

Red Moon occupies a specific and unusual tonal position in the range. It is a warm, dark red — the kind of red that reads as grounded and earthy rather than bright or aggressive. The terracotta-orange quality gives it a natural, almost autumnal character that connects it to the same palette as brown leather, brick, rust, and ochre. It is further from the cool formality of Bordeaux and closer to the warm end of the red spectrum — a colour that belongs in streetwear, casual smart, and creative contexts.

The product images tell the full story: this is a sock that works with New Balance 550s, Air Force 1s, and raw denim. It creates a warm accent that ties together the earthy, warm-neutral palette that dominates contemporary casual menswear. Against dark denim it glows. Against cream or ecru trousers it reads as a bold warm statement. Against tan or brown leather it blends into the warm palette in a way that a cooler red never could.

Specifications
  • Composition: 75% organic combed cotton · 23% polyamide · 2% elastane
  • Needle count: 200-needle fine-rib knit — approximately twice the density of standard mass-market socks
  • Toe: Hand-linked — closed by hand, virtually seamless against the foot
  • Certification: OEKO-TEX Standard 100 — every component tested, including the red moon dye
  • Length: Mid-calf / traditional crew shaft
  • Finish: Pre-washed and steamed — comfortable from the first wear
  • Sizes: EU 41–46 — size guide →
  • Origin: Designed in Copenhagen, Est. 2011 · Crafted in Istanbul

FAQ

What shade of red is Red Moon exactly?

Red Moon is a dark, warm red with terracotta-orange undertones — closer to a rusty brick than a fire-engine red or a true scarlet. The name references the deep, coppery red of a lunar eclipse: rich, warm, and slightly earthy. It is not as cool or dark as wine; not as bright or orange as vermilion. It occupies the tonal range between a rust and a classic red — the kind of red that reads as warm and grounded rather than bold and aggressive.

What is the difference between Red Moon and Bordeaux?

Bordeaux is a deep, cool-toned wine-red — dark, formal, and strongest in autumn and winter with suits and dark trousers. Red Moon is a warm, earthy dark red with orange undertones — casual, grounded, and closest to the rust-brick palette that works with denim, white sneakers, and brown leather. Bordeaux disappears into formal contexts; Red Moon energises casual ones. Both are warm-weather-to-autumn colours, but they serve entirely different wardrobes and moods.

What is the difference between Red Moon and Watermelon?

Watermelon is a light, vivid coral — a pink-red that is clearly summer, casual, and high-energy. Red Moon is a dark, muted warm red — deeper, earthier, and more versatile across seasons. Watermelon belongs to the spring/summer wardrobe with white chinos and linen; Red Moon belongs across seasons, particularly in autumn, with denim and leather. Watermelon is bright; Red Moon is rich.

What outfits work best with Red Moon socks?

The strongest pairings are with dark denim and white sneakers — the warm rust-red sock creates a perfect warm accent that ties together the casual palette. White or off-white chinos with tan leather loafers work equally well. Camel wool trousers in autumn create a tonal earth-tone pairing. The key is keeping the outfit in the warm-neutral register — creams, tans, browns, and denim — rather than cool tones like grey or navy, which reduce the warmth of the colour.

Are these socks organic and certified?

Yes. Made from 75% organic combed cotton, 23% polyamide, and 2% elastane. The cotton is certified organic, grown without synthetic pesticides or fertilisers. The finished sock carries OEKO-TEX Standard 100 certification, confirming every component — including the red moon dye — has been independently tested and verified free of harmful substances.
